Pet Vaccinations for Dogs
A standard pet dog vaccination, such as is a C5 vaccination, at your regional veterinarian center in Amherst NS will offer defense against parvovirus, distemper, hepatitis, bordetella and parainfluenza (kennel cough). Normally, the kennel cough part will only last 12 months therefore yearly boosters will be needed. The regional veterinarians at Cumberland County Animal Hospital can recommend you on whether additional vaccinations for your pet dog, such as leptospirosis vaccination is needed for your pet. This vaccination for pet dogs is normally available at an extra expense.

Pet Vaccinations for Cats
The standard vaccination for cats such as, an F3 vaccination by your regional vets in Amherst NS will provide defense against panleukopenia virus (feline enteritis), herpesvirus (cat flu), and calicivirus (feline flu). Depending on your feline’s risk profile and cat vaccination schedule, your regional veterinarians at Cumberland County Animal Hospital might likewise advise vaccination versus Feline Aids (FIV vaccination). This cat vaccination is available at an extra expense.

Pet Vaccinations for Rabbits
At least, once a year, rabbits require vaccination for calicivirus. There are times, your local vets at Cumberland County Animal Hospital may advise a shorter period between vaccinations depending upon the regional threat to your bunny relating to the local authority’s calicivirus releases.
